Output 84240ec5564ee24b2c59838f4735b48ffb22ec62b39cda0ba521743852882430:3

value
1039502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59e224753a8df8c72dfc3b2c3d06cbe547ef5e10 OP_EQUALVERIFY OP_CHECKSIG
address
19CG3ix753BtxsvcoqtbCW7spe4ty1J32F
transaction
84240ec5564ee24b2c59838f4735b48ffb22ec62b39cda0ba521743852882430
spent
true